Matt Kenyon from the South East Melbourne Phoenix opens up about the struggles and questions we all face, whether that’s as a person or in your career as an athlete. Matt talks about his shift in mindset when it comes to basketball, the importance of journalling and meditation when it comes to his mental health, and the gap in the Australian market when it comes to Australian athletes and their brands.
